Installation work of medical equipment is in full swing at the newly built multi-speciality block at the Thoothukudi Government Medical College and Hospital, which is expected to be inaugurated soon.The 650-bed facility was constructed at an outlay of ₹136.35 is expected to significantly strengthen the hospital’s capacity to provide specialised medical care . Of the total project cost around ₹16 crore has been allocated for procurement of hi-tech diagnostic and surgical equipment, while the remaining amount was used for civil works. The project is jointly funded by union government and State government in the ratio 60:40The new block is being equipped with advanced medical facilities to cater to a growing number of patients from Thoothukudi and neighbouring districts. The additional block is expected to ease congestion in existing wards and enhance the hospital’s ability to provide specialised treatment and diagnostic services.In January 2026, Additional Health Secretary S. Uma inspected the new facility built in Thoothukudi and exhorted the Public Works Department to expedite the completion of works and installation of medical equipment.According to a hospital administration official, the installation of key equipment such as CT scan, digital X-ray,ultra sound machines has already been completed, with the installation and calibration of other equipment currently underway. The official added that oxygen cylinders required for the facility have arrived and pipeline connections were yet to be completed. Published - March 05, 2026 08:29 pm IST
